Transaction 21ffad2359bb76408e3b33be91cda470839bcb3db9f46a5b356a77080fe0a958

1 Input
2 Outputs
  • 21ffad2359bb76408e3b33be91cda470839bcb3db9f46a5b356a77080fe0a958:0
  • value  25308506
    address  bc1qzy6cr3jr4r4992gq8r73tup2p2errr53cgec29
  • 21ffad2359bb76408e3b33be91cda470839bcb3db9f46a5b356a77080fe0a958:1
  • value  438779
    address  3KhKz4ZfAY94obnU1jSaJ4Z7kyFybLhTEn